“Untourable Album” is effortlessly versatile, perfect for both rainy, melancholic days and sunny, tranquil afternoons. Its soft vocals and smooth production create a calming atmosphere, whether you’re reflecting on a gray day with tracks like “Oh Dove” or enjoying the mellow warmth of “Sugar” on a summer afternoon.
